enlightenment: version bump

This commit is contained in:
Anton Bolshakov 2012-11-06 13:57:33 +00:00
parent 009c26247d
commit 2d0a4ec4be
2 changed files with 86 additions and 0 deletions

View file

@ -1,4 +1,6 @@
AUX gentoo-sysactions.conf 3056 SHA256 5939973a9fbaaba81751e936fb541d6aebd7ec1c599174ea568f5a579356939f SHA512 688f02cbff0d50a847eb08ca7832699b836adca9b22e15a780943a8e5a8213aac04b335cfdf3cb96adbff238f681ae8954a720153e8e35b2afaba3225d53206a WHIRLPOOL 0c05e0d295ede8b2f436a87c4b98876fed64d5cc780f13bb6bde1a74a3c87847f2f90ab482a61c2b39f20894572329f5497e5da22537261eef2f0a9fb33ce56d
AUX quickstart.diff 474 SHA256 9201674d2f8707f216e18c471f0a4a5a7366b3dd32cb8ec131ca1795a10bb3e6 SHA512 b8df654dd1246ea6391017fe9856e38d209b250625f8343aa4943a4eeed980447eb52c6a15fe170bcab90b76e5670ee9c7f98358bb87990877e312cc4cea8f6c WHIRLPOOL 7ea473b01d46ab1ae10ed50d9991de652e3c2945390a71dfa3cba4bf7c6d8ae526dbd18a275db7bd714be7e48414b90ea470c46d2460c68512ede070025b9c49
DIST enlightenment-0.16.999.77927.tar.bz2 15429503 SHA256 c41a835dff019f98917c7ab53cbe42d717b181f280627ad4f3a9cf1e7171db9c SHA512 e88ae8919616cc693ade1dd9ff76f90eeda367ee112144e1ba9e4b9b7b35221405f03682190ea1c6da50299a8e1d31cd1dbd6cbc638434c7e6afdf2786c5e143 WHIRLPOOL d2a863b9441111fa4a72f4514d14808ff8252fd9ace03c9857435aad018e69f5421afb92d968a16f1a12eede8ae2f05735f09f87d5b00be7e180377e15e0ead2
DIST enlightenment-0.17.0-alpha.tar.gz 17874597 SHA256 588eaa173b93ed5167bc6ee54f3ba14deff968c7b281d183343413db438ca076 SHA512 9d85ecbcc60dade266d5d176dcd657e27b99cb71e80ae0bf16e484f2a35f3c6531790c502b21b34b13799eb9d4688cf0740f9219cd0b27ffcb59e91cae0ec433 WHIRLPOOL 3f38521648aadb9f551326da09c42f7e5e7998b8096c792fd74234962f3aaa068dbcc1dad672358367d60a23a79eddf8dcdbf6b6c1e2c05d0f55290fcd8e3eff
EBUILD enlightenment-0.16.999.77927.ebuild 2354 SHA256 c6b78683f11c7005e60adfb8c5ec0152f85fe05cfd420427b97907f95addf5df SHA512 a7142d8cc409c6883024cecaf90a619c966a8f93735cba1fe5c00a03f206c82de1b1ca886dd2f2db323f6200101a8fbbecdeb6033cc47d542c114e224479b09d WHIRLPOOL 4d43218efecb4dff542a5cb19f884116b6d0c503043178ed9c6275b9a4e87bcbfd95370feb5f5fb55a9441f8828611c13130bcfb070d9e3eeb840e9de0f5e2ee
EBUILD enlightenment-0.17.0_alpha.ebuild 2488 SHA256 c4ce54dd0af0b3096ecddbeb40d805cc3831787b052364e51554bf7c331ccd73 SHA512 400ba3548bcd43f680c8801223b22025cda0020c25b0fc31f5b4b7bbf50e981194e67ec1a201e6d41bb9135fa0376d915d4e304c4921c87fb44d287cea5c995a WHIRLPOOL 7b09b3f6233b9d1c104085e768934213e74e56b93da79bb8b7574209f47ab9129796842b5ed523a04e64b3410409c217168aefd04c8d410125c48a0cfc2ccce6

View file

@ -0,0 +1,84 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: $
EAPI="4"
E_SNAP_DATE="releases"
inherit enlightenment
MY_P="${PN}-${PV//_/-}"
DESCRIPTION="Enlightenment DR17 window manager"
SRC_URI="http://download.enlightenment.org/releases/${MY_P}.tar.gz"
SLOT="0.17"
# The @ is just an anchor to expand from
__EVRY_MODS=""
__CONF_MODS="
+@applications +@dialogs +@display +@edgebindings
+@interaction +@intl +@keybindings +@menus
+@paths +@performance +@randr +@shelves +@theme
+@wallpaper2 +@window-manipulation +@window-remembers"
__NORM_MODS="
@access +@backlight +@battery +@clock +@comp +@connman +@cpufreq +@dropshadow
+@everything +@fileman +@fileman-opinfo +@gadman +@ibar +@ibox +@illume2
+@mixer +@msgbus +@notification @ofono +@pager +@quickaccess +@shot +@start +@syscon
+@systray +@tasks +@temperature +@tiling +@winlist +@wizard +@xkbswitch"
IUSE_E_MODULES="
${__CONF_MODS//@/e_modules_conf-}
${__NORM_MODS//@/e_modules_}"
IUSE="bluetooth exchange pam spell static-libs +udev ukit ${IUSE_E_MODULES}"
S="${WORKDIR}/enlightenment-0.17.0-alpha"
RDEPEND="exchange? ( >=app-misc/exchange-9999 )
pam? ( sys-libs/pam )
>=dev-libs/efreet-1.7.0
>=dev-libs/eio-1.7.0
>=dev-libs/eina-1.7.0[mempool-chained]
|| ( >=dev-libs/ecore-1.7.0[X,evas,inotify] >=dev-libs/ecore-1.7.0[xcb,evas,inotify] )
>=media-libs/edje-1.7.0
>=dev-libs/e_dbus-1.7.0[libnotify,udev?]
ukit? ( >=dev-libs/e_dbus-1.7.0[udev] )
e_modules_connman? ( >=dev-libs/e_dbus-1.7.0[connman] )
e_modules_ofono? ( >=dev-libs/e_dbus-1.7.0[ofono] )
|| ( >=media-libs/evas-1.7.0[eet,X,jpeg,png] >=media-libs/evas-1.7.0[eet,xcb,jpeg,png] )
bluetooth? ( net-wireless/bluez )
>=dev-libs/eeze-1.7.0"
DEPEND="${RDEPEND}"
src_prepare() {
epatch "${FILESDIR}"/quickstart.diff
enlightenment_src_prepare
}
src_configure() {
export MY_ECONF="
--disable-install-sysactions
--disable-elementary
$(use_enable bluetooth bluez)
$(use_enable doc)
$(use_enable exchange)
--disable-device-hal
--disable-mount-hal
$(use_enable nls)
$(use_enable pam)
--enable-device-udev
$(use_enable udev mount-eeze)
$(use_enable ukit mount-udisks)
"
local u c
for u in ${IUSE_E_MODULES} ; do
u=${u#+}
c=${u#e_modules_}
MY_ECONF+=" $(use_enable ${u} ${c})"
done
enlightenment_src_configure
}
src_install() {
enlightenment_src_install
insinto /etc/enlightenment
newins "${FILESDIR}"/gentoo-sysactions.conf sysactions.conf || die
}